Earlier this month, the company announced a plan to invest about $1 billion to expand its Warren Technical Center, in Warren, Mich. The R&D facility, which already employs about 19,000 engineers and techies, will add 2,600 new jobs.

GM Financial operates at nearly 45 locations globally. Around 30 are in the US. The US generates about 80% of GM’s overall revenue. GM’s cars and trucks are marketed and sold through a network of approximately 12,600 independent distributors, dealers, and authorized sales, service, and parts outlets all over the world.

China was the largest single target market for General Motors in 2020. During the 2020 fiscal year, the Detroit company and its associations sold some 2.9 million motor vehicles to customers in China, the world’s largest automobile market.

In 2020, General Motors sold about 6.8 million vehicles.

Fortunately though, GM, or rather “New GM” has fully recovered and it’s now producing some of its best cars ever. But how many cars has GM built in its entire 106-year history? The answer is more than 500 million. The automaker was founded in 1908 and, in its own words, “reborn in 2009.”
